Investing through unregulated brokers like fidelitycapitals.ai poses significant risks. Without regulatory oversight, investors lack protections against fraud, have no recourse for disputes, and face a higher likelihood of exit scams, where brokers disappear without returning client funds.How Can “ReviewsAdvice” Help You If You Get Scammed?
